Preheat oven to 375F.
Drop the ground beef into a large skillet over medium-high heat and break it apart.
Add the diced onions to the skillet. Stir well and continue cooking until the ground beef is fully browned.
Spray a 9 x 13 inch baking dish well with cooking spray.
Pour the frozen pierogies into the baking dish and spread them out evenly.
Pour 1 can of the red enchilada sauce over the pierogies.
Spoon the cooked ground beef and onions over the pierogies.
Sprinkle 1 cup of the shredded cheddar over top.
Pour the remaining can of enchilada sauce over everything.
Sprinkle the remaining 2 cups of shredded cheddar cheese over top.
Cover the dish with aluminum foil.
Place the dish in the oven and bake for 40 minutes. Remove the foil and continue baking for 5 - 10 minutes uncovered to finish melting the cheese.
Remove the dish from the oven and allow it to rest for 5 minutes to allow the sauce to thicken up.
